Best Disney Vehicle

Best Disney Vehicle

What is the best vehicle from any Disney show or movie?  To arrive at an answer, we first had to ask ourselves what defines a vehicle.  We decided that a vehicle is anything designed to transport some THING to some PLACE.  So Mary Poppins’ umbrella, the Millennium Falcon, Aladdin’s carpet, and the roller coaster from Phineas and Ferb are all options.  But that’s just scratching the surface.  Read More…
